Previous Version This is a previous version of SECTION: Nicholas. Every winter, the few geese that are left still migrate to the south. After all this time, and everything that's happened to us, some things just never change. The geese don't stick around cause it's too cold. Why would ANYONE want to stick around here anyways? You come visit, laugh at how sad it is, and then you leave. You don't stick around. I saw one fly past the broken window beside me in my Time Studies class. There’s about 8 of us, and we’re a tight group of friends. It’s been so long since I've seen the sun, but it thankfully decided to come out of the clouds today, and say hello to us survivors. An ugly, gray haze usually lingered in the air for some reason, but the sun swept it away. It felt nice to have its rays rest on the surface my skin, it was literally the brightest part of my week. “Blah blah blah blah blah blah blah,” Said my teacher. Every word that’s ever stumbled out of his mouth was pure bullshit. Ever since our government fell, we could just walk out of class and never show up again, but the reason why I’m here, unlike hundreds of kids who left, is because I need to get out of here. How odd does that sound? What I’m trying to do, is find a way to travel into the future- where I can get away from this hell they call Earth. BRRINNGG! Everyone ran out the door that still hung on one hinge.“That is your homework for today, please come again!” Mr. Ghib yelled into the halls. He sighed. I never really noticed how ugly this school is. The blackboard is really gray, there’s holes in the pale red brick pattern, the chairs and desks are half broken and scattered around the room...and I never noticed. “Is there something you need, Ivy?” He said, startling me. “Oh no, sir, I was just thinking. Bye!” I said as I jogged away. Little did I know, that would be the last time I’d speak with him. I gently hopped up the creaky, old stairs up to my room. My roommates and I haven't really decorated our home, but we did make the door look nice. On the front, we put pictures of 4 Disney Princesses- they were popular in the 1990’s, I think. We had Belle to represent me, Snow white for Yari, Ariel for Byrd, and Myka as Cinderella. I have long, thick and slightly wavy brown hair. I have very pale, imperfect skin and a few freckles across my cheeks. Yari has cute, short black hair and she has porcelain skin. Her body is very long and slender with pretty little piano fingers and smooth shoulders. Her mutation is a common one, she can shape shift. Byrd is very unique, she has fiery red-orange hair that she keeps on the top of her head in a messy bun, and drowns in her freckles. Her mutation allows her to make doubles of herself. Then there’s Myka, she wears her blonde hair in a ponytail every day, and she can breathe underwater. I never got along with Myka, she always rubs her ability in my face. I knocked loudly on the door. “Hey Ivy!” Myka said as she opened the door. I gave a fake smile and walked in to head pounding music. “Like the new lights?” Byrd asked. I looked over at my bed. It had beautiful, yellow, star shaped LED lights all around and a big Star Wars poster. My bed was perfectly made, and the lights made my perfectly white bed look so pure and pretty. “Say something!” Byrd said. She hopped onto my bed and grabbed my hands. I stood on the bed with her and she showed me all the little detail of the poster. “We know you love ancient things, so we thought this would be a nice present,” She said with a wink. I genuinely laughed and hugged her so tight, I could of cut off her circulation. No matter what happens in this world, there’s one thing and one thing only that matters; and that’s love. Whether its family love or friend love, love makes the world go round. It breathes life into everything and keeps us going.
